The Advantages of Being a Young Dad
One of the key advantages of being a young dad is the potential for increased energy and involvement in a daughter‘s life. Younger fathers often find it easier to keep up with the demands of parenting, engaging in physical activities, and participating in their daughter‘s hobbies and interests. This active involvement can foster a deeper connection and create lasting memories.
Furthermore, young dads may be more attuned to contemporary trends and cultural shifts, allowing them to better understand and relate to their daughter‘s experiences. This can facilitate open communication and a stronger sense of camaraderie. They might find it easier to connect with their daughter on social media, understand the nuances of youth culture, and offer relevant advice in a rapidly changing world. The young dad may also be more open to new parenting styles and approaches, leading to a more collaborative and responsive parenting style.
Building a Strong Foundation: Communication and Trust
Open and honest communication is the cornerstone of any healthy relationship, and it’s especially crucial between a young dad and his daughter. Creating a safe space for dialogue, where she feels comfortable sharing her thoughts and feelings without judgment, is paramount. Active listening, empathy, and genuine interest in her perspective will strengthen the bond and foster trust. Regular conversations, even about seemingly trivial matters, can build a foundation of understanding and connection.
Trust is earned over time through consistent actions and unwavering support. A young dad must demonstrate reliability, integrity, and a commitment to his daughter‘s well-being. Keeping promises, being present during important moments, and offering unconditional love will solidify her trust and create a secure attachment.
Navigating the Challenges: Maturity and Stability
While there are numerous advantages to being a young dad, there are also challenges that must be addressed. One of the primary concerns is the potential for immaturity and instability. Younger fathers may still be navigating their own personal and professional development, which can impact their ability to provide consistent support and guidance. Financial stability can also be a significant hurdle, particularly in the early years of parenting.
To overcome these challenges, it’s essential for young dads to prioritize personal growth and seek support when needed. This may involve continuing education, career advancement, or therapy to address any underlying emotional or psychological issues. Building a strong support network of family, friends, or mentors can provide invaluable assistance and guidance during difficult times. A young dad‘s ability to demonstrate maturity and stability plays a vital role in creating a secure and nurturing environment for his daughter.
The Role of the Mother: Co-Parenting and Collaboration
In many cases, the relationship between a young dad and his daughter is shaped by the co-parenting dynamic with the mother. Whether they are in a committed relationship or co-parenting separately, effective communication and collaboration are essential for the daughter‘s well-being. Establishing clear boundaries, agreeing on parenting styles, and prioritizing the daughter‘s needs above all else will create a stable and consistent environment.
Even when there are disagreements or challenges in the co-parenting relationship, it’s crucial to maintain a respectful and civil tone in front of the daughter. Protecting her from conflict and ensuring she feels loved and supported by both parents is paramount. Open communication, flexibility, and a willingness to compromise will contribute to a more harmonious co-parenting arrangement.

Addressing Difficult Topics: Honesty and Openness
As a daughter grows, she will inevitably encounter difficult topics and challenging situations. A young dad must be prepared to address these issues with honesty, openness, and sensitivity. This may involve discussing topics such as relationships, sexuality, peer pressure, and social justice. Providing age-appropriate information, answering her questions truthfully, and offering guidance and support will help her navigate these complex issues.
Creating a safe space for her to share her concerns, fears, and doubts without judgment is crucial. Active listening, empathy, and a willingness to engage in difficult conversations will strengthen the bond and build trust. A young dad should be a reliable source of information and support, helping his daughter make informed decisions and navigate the challenges of adolescence and adulthood.
